Things You'll Need:
- One sheet of 8 1/2 x 11 inch paper or 9 x 12 inch construction paper
- Scissors (optional)
-
Step 1
Neatly fold the paper in half lengthwise. Or as your elementary school teacher might have said, "Fold it like a hotdog."
-
Step 2
Undo the fold, opening the paper to its original size and shape. You will see the crease down the middle.
-
Step 3
Fold the paper in half the other way . . . like a hamburger! Keep it folded.
-
Step 4
Take each side of the paper and fold it back toward the middle fold.
-
Step 5
Turn the paper so that the main, middle fold is pointing up. Find the middle, vertical crease on the main fold and either cut or tear it, stopping when you reach the perpendicular crease.
-
Step 6
Grip the paper on the main, middle fold on each side of the cut. Gently pull the two sides down in opposite directions, bringing them together until you've folded it completely in half.
-
Step 7
Press the pages together. Tad-a! You have a six-page mini-book to write and illustrate.
